Summerville, located in South Carolina, offers a variety of activities and attractions that reflect its charming Southern character. One of the best ways to appreciate the town is by exploring Azalea Park, known for its beautiful gardens and walking paths. This park features a serene atmosphere and is ideal for leisurely strolls or picnics.
Another notable site is the Summerville Historic District, where visitors can admire well-preserved antebellum architecture. This area provides insight into the town's history and is perfect for those interested in architecture and local heritage. Additionally, the town hosts several events throughout the year, such as the Flowertown Festival, which showcases local crafts, food, and artwork, making it a great opportunity to experience the community spirit.
For those interested in outdoor activities, Dorchester County's parks and recreation areas offer various options for hiking, biking, and fishing. The area's natural beauty can be explored through its many trails and waterways. Moreover, local shops and restaurants provide a taste of Southern cuisine and hospitality. Dining options often highlight regional specialties, allowing visitors to enjoy the local flavors.
Lastly, immersing oneself in the local arts scene is also worthwhile. The Summerville Arts Center often features exhibitions and workshops, supporting local artists and providing opportunities for visitors to engage with the community's creative side. Overall, Summerville presents a blend of nature, history, and culture, making it a pleasant destination for various interests.
